Conolidine was initial synthesized in 2011 as Component of a analyze by Tarselli et al. (60) The very first de novo pathway to artificial manufacturing discovered that their synthesized type served as helpful analgesics versus Continual, persistent soreness within an in-vivo design (sixty). A biphasic pain design was used, by which formalin Resolution is injected right into a rodent’s paw. This leads to a Key soreness response right away following injection and a secondary discomfort reaction 20 - 40 minutes after injection (sixty two).
